Physical properties
Hardness of 7 on the Mohs scale, purple to violet color, vitreous luster, hexagonal crystal system, conchoidal fracture, specific gravity of 2.65
Formation & geological history
Formed in hydrothermal veins and cavities within volcanic rocks (vugs or geodes) as iron impurities are irradiated within a quartz matrix.
Uses & applications
Used primarily in jewelry, ornamental carvings, crystal healing, and mineral collecting.
Geological facts
Amethyst was once considered as valuable as diamond, ruby, and emerald until large deposits were discovered in Brazil during the 19th century.
Field identification & locations
Easily identified by its distinctive purple coloration and quartz hardness; commonly found worldwide, particularly in Brazil, Uruguay, Zambia, and the USA.
